About Southend

Southend carries a quiet dignity, a place where London's sprawling embrace begins to soften into the gentle contours of Kent. It lies 11.0 km south-south-east of City of London (from City of London: bearing 149°T, OS grid TQ 383 719), and is situated north-north-west of Keston village.
